loose trunk lid

what has to be tightened to get my trunk lid to close tighter?

it is a 91 sunbird

Not sure bout a sunbird..

but there should be 2 ( maybe 3 ) bolts that whole the latch..
Name:  TRUNK.jpg
Views: 20
Size:  61.2 KB

Simply loosen it and push it upward a lil more..retighten.. test.. when it's perfect.. tighten it down good

If your latch is @ the bottom instead of on the lid.. well.. you may have to take the panel off if it's in the way
